Variant summary

Our verdict is Likely benign. Variant got -2 ACMG points: 2P and 4B. PM2BP4_Strong

The NM_014653.4(WSCD2):c.833C>A(p.Thr278Asn) variant causes a missense change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.0000149 in 1,614,092 control chromosomes in the GnomAD database, with no homozygous occurrence. In-silico tool predicts a benign outcome for this variant. 16/21 in silico tools predict a benign outcome for this variant. Variant has been reported in ClinVar as Uncertain significance (★).

Uncertain significance, criteria provided, single submitterclinical testingAmbry GeneticsMay 25, 2022The c.833C>A (p.T278N) alteration is located in exon 6 (coding exon 5) of the WSCD2 gene. This alteration results from a C to A substitution at nucleotide position 833, causing the threonine (T) at amino acid position 278 to be replaced by an asparagine (N). Based on insufficient or conflicting evidence, the clinical significance of this alteration remains unclear. -
